Can chocolate with alcohol make you drunk?

A standard shot is 30 millilitres so you would need to eat almost four 100-gram blocks of chocolate to get one shot of liqueur. Most people would need to consume more than 700 grams of chocolate to be over the legal blood alcohol limit. To get quite drunk, most would need to eat close to two kilograms.

How long should I wait to drink beer after eating?

Wait to have your first sip of booze at least 15 minutes after you begin your meal, Hunnes says. If you drink right at the start of a meal or on an empty stomach before the meal, the alcohol will immediately be absorbed into the stomach since there's nothing else in there to slow the absorption rate.

What beer goes with chocolate?

Stout beers tend to be the easiest to pair with often due to coffee and chocolate notes in their flavors. A stout beer will pair well with a higher percentage dark chocolate. Bitter ales like IPA's pair well with a medium body dark chocolate.

What is greening out mean?

What is 'greening out'? Greening out (also known as 'whiting out') is a term used to describe a situation where a person feels sick after smoking cannabis. They go pale (turning 'green' or 'white') and start to sweat, they feel dizzy and nauseous, and may even start vomiting.

Why does sugar help when drunk?

Sugar attenuated alcohol intoxication at this time without influencing blood alcohol levels. Contrary to previous reports, the combination of alcohol and sugar failed to produce significant hypoglycemia, or any of the adverse behavioral effects associated with hypoglycemia, at later times after drink ingestion.
